Arab League chief signals divisions on Syria crisis
Amr Moussa says Arab states "worried, angry, actively watching crisis in Syria," adds countries are debating common stance on situation.
The head of the Arab League voiced "worry" on Monday about almost three months of clashes in Syria but signaled division in the 22-member body over how to proceed.
"Though their views differ, Arab states are all worried, angry and actively monitoring the current crisis in Syria," Secretary-General Amr Moussa said in a statement….
